## Job Content

### Job overview

Are you looking to start your career in a fascinating and rewarding area of reproductive healthcare?

NUH Life is seeking an enthusiastic and motivated Andrology Practitioner to join our multidisciplinary NHS fertility team. This post is designed to develop specialist expertise in all aspects of diagnostic and therapeutic andrology and is best suited to candidates seeking a long-term career in Male Fertility.

This is far more than a routine diagnostic laboratory role. Alongside semen analysis, you will gain experience in sperm preparation techniques, male fertility preservation and sperm donor banking - helping patients at some of the most important moments in their lives.

## Person Specification

### Experience

**Essential**

- Practical experience in an Andrology or Reproductive Science laboratory
- Demonstrable commitment and interest in diagnosis and treatment of male infertility

**Desirable**

- Experience of patient and donor sample cryopreservation
- Experience working in a HFEA licensed centre

### Physical Skills

**Essential**

- Physical ability to move large/heavy nitrogen cylinders and withstand working at very low temperature for short periods of time with appropriate PPE.
- Manual dexterity and technical skills associated with the discipline, e.g. use of microscopes, centrifuges, pipettes, cryofreezers

**Desirable**

- Experience of handling of liquid nitrogen, filling and operation of nitrogen refrigerators

### Role related requirements

**Essential**

- Willing to work unsocial hours as and when required
- Full driving licence and access to vehicle whilst on call

### Training and Qualifications

**Essential**

- Minimum 2:1 in BSc in a relevant Biological Science

**Desirable**

- MSc in Reproductive Science
- ABA certificate (module 1) or equivalent ARCS training module

### Analytical and Judgement skills

**Essential**

- Competent in basic laboratory/technical skills (use of microscopes, pipettes and centrifuges)
- Practical experience of semen analysis and sperm preparation methods
- Understanding of current regulation including HFEA’s code of practice

**Desirable**

- Knowledge and understanding of quality management within a laboratory setting

### Planning and Organisational Skills

**Essential**

- Ability to prioritise conflicting workloads and meet set deadlines
- Punctual

### Communication and Relationship skills

**Essential**

- Excellent written and spoken English in order to convey complex information to patients, relatives, staff and colleagues
- Able to demonstrate understanding and empathy for all patients requiring our services

**Desirable**

- Evidence of Patient/Client contact
